Quick Facts: History
• 1982: Incorporated by leaders of the business, hospitality, aviation communities
• 1992: Created the Travelers Assistance Program
• 2005: Strategic plan positioned the organization for growth
• 2008: MAC Commission approved the Master Art Plan
• 2014: Second strategic plan directed next phase of growth

The Airport Foundation MSP dedicates itself to enhancing the experience and exceeding the expectations of travelers at MSP International Airport, as well as supporting the airport and broader aviation community.

Quick Facts: Volunteers
Total volunteers YE 2014: 395
Total number of hours donated: 66,937
Value of hours: $1,481,985.00
Total Passengers Served: 1,686,860
Activities Update:
Grants 1982 – 2014
Airport Beautification $1,219,322
Passenger Amenities $323,185
Aviation Related Organizations $411,277
Arts $367,192
Airport Community Events $128,230
Reliever Airport Air Shows $50,500
Travelers Assistance $5,342,308
$7,762,014
